How Crystal Jaramillo Became More Successful as an Apartment Locator
What did you do before you came to AptAmigo?

Before AptAmigo, I spent time in traditional and investment real estate. My real estate career really started to blossom when I took a position at a discount brokerage. Despite all the warnings I received prior, my team did a large number of transactions, which equaled LOTS of knowledge and experience. This experience landed me a salaried position at another company, where I made a comfortable living. I thought that was it, my career was set, and it would be smooth sailing from here on out! That was not the case; the market shifted, and I was laid off.
Unready to give up on my dream of being a successful real estate agent, I transitioned into investment real estate. I loved this side of real estate and all the new challenges and learning experiences it brought. Unfortunately, some of these challenges involved a super-saturated market and financial demands that, as a single mom, I could not afford.
Why apartment locating and why now?
I was still not ready to leave the world of real estate, so I began to look once again at my options. After working with both investors and traditional buyers, the words rent and lease kept popping up. Right now, many people simply cannot afford to purchase a home and are renting instead, indicating that more opportunity lies in that sector. Plus, I needed a way to continue to work on my real estate goals and support my family while building this dream.

What’s the biggest challenge you’ve faced in this job, and how did you overcome it?
For me, the biggest challenge is achieving work-life balance, especially when first starting out. I put a lot of pressure on myself, and that often meant late nights, early mornings, every weekend, and all the time in between. This struggle has been an issue for me in general as a real estate agent. Now that I am locating, I have been able to set personal goals, and when I reach these goals I give myself breaks. It has been easier to do that given the volume of sales I am able to do here at AptAmigo.
